Bands: Cycotic Youth is still cyco after all these years

News — March 19, 2022

Back in action after roughly 30 years, Cycotic Youth shared a new song this week, "Cycofied." Formed in the Venice, CA skate scene alongside Suicidal Tendencies, the band is reborn now under the wing of vocalist Jason Brown and a new lineup, while continuing the punk-meets-thrash-meets-metal hybrid sound. …

Records: Holy Youth sign to Happenin'

News — October 4, 2014

Happenin' Records has signed Holy Youth, who will release a self-titled album on Oct. 14. The dream punk band from Alabama previously released a four-song EP in 2013. The s/t album will be their debut full-length.

Records: Sonic Highways headed for video

News — March 12, 2015

Foo Fighters' HBO Series Sonic Highways is headed for DVD, Blu Ray, and digital release on April 7.The series follows the band and musical history across 8 US cities, in the process of recording their album of the same title, released last year.

Bands: New band and tour from Kim Gordon

News — July 28, 2013

Noise uo Body/Head, featuring ex-Sonic Youth Kim Gordon and Bill Nace, will release Coming Apart on Sept. 10 via Matador Records. The duo is also planning a short tour in September

Tours: Chelsea Light Moving tour

News — February 22, 2013

Thurston Moore's post-Sonic Youth band Chelsea Light Moving will be on tour this March. The band is also set to release a self-titled debut on March 5 via Matador Records.
